site stats

Opencl fortran

Web25 de fev. de 2024 · The C bitwise or cannot be used in Fortran. You have to use +.The ior() function would probably also work, but I would use +*.It works because the valued of the constants are normally designed in such a way that they have only one 1 bit and every time at a different position. *If you do use + you may not add the same flag twice, it flags … WebThe Intel® Fortran Compiler Classic provides continuity with existing CPU-focused workflows. This compiler is part of the Intel® oneAPI HPC Toolkit. The installer package …

Passing two options as arguments in OpenCL with Fortran …

WebIntel End User License Agreement (EULA) The software development products you install may use a prior version of the EULA. Priority Support Your software purchase includes free updates and access to Intel engineers for assistance with technical issues. Eligibility How to Request Support Submit a Ticket FAQ Product and Performance Information 1 WebHome · Theory & Computation Events (Indico) grace church finder https://3dlights.net

Intel® oneAPI standalone component installation files

Web16 de nov. de 2024 · With support for NVIDIA GPUs and x86-64, OpenPOWER, or Arm CPUs running Linux, the NVIDIA HPC SDK provides proven tools and technologies for building cross-platform, performance-portable, and scalable HPC applications. The NVIDIA HPC SDK includes the NVIDIA HPC Fortran compiler, NVFORTRAN. WebROCm ships its Installable Client Driver ICD loader and an OpenCL implementation bundled together. As of January 2024, ROCm 4.5.2 ships OpenCL 2.2, and is lagging behind competition. ... allowing users to migrate from CUDA Fortran to HIP Fortran. It is also in the repertoire of research projects, even more so. WebTechnical documentation for Zen Software Studio offerings tuned for AMD EPYC processors, including AMD Optimizing C/C++ and Fortran Compilers (“AOCC”), AMD … grace church fish fry

Home · Theory & Computation Events (Indico)

Category:NVIDIA HPC SDK Version 23.3 Documentation

Tags:Opencl fortran

Opencl fortran

Heterogeneous Computing With Opencl 2 0 By David R Kaeli Pdf …

WebFortranCL is an OpenCL interface for Fortran 90. It allows programmers to call OpenCL directly from Fortran. Kernels are still written in C. The interface is designed to be as … WebOpenCL™ (Open Computing Language) is an open, royalty-free standard for cross-platform, parallel programming of diverse accelerators found in supercomputers, cloud servers, personal computers, mobile devices and embedded platforms. OpenCL greatly improves the speed and responsiveness of a wide spectrum of applications in numerous …

Opencl fortran

Did you know?

Web23 de jun. de 2009 · Yours is the first request I have seen for OpenCL support in Fortran, but as I think it is mainly an API, I don't see why you couldn't use it with a suitable library. From our perspective, based on input from numerous customers, we are focusing on the Fortran 2008 Co-Array feature to provide parallelism in a "Fortran" way. WebTranspyle intends to support selected subsets of: C, C++, Cython, Fortran, OpenCL and Python. For each language pair and direction of translation, the set of supported features may differ. C to Python AST C-specific AST is created via pycparse, and some of elementary C syntax is transformed into Python AST. Python AST to C Not implemented …

Web21 de fev. de 2011 · Do I really need to be experienced in Python and/or OpenCL? My background is in fortran and as a matter of fact I need to translate and parallelize a … WebOpenCL (Open Computing Language) is an open, royalty-free parallel programming specification developed by the Khronos Group, a non-profit consortium. The OpenCL specification describes a programming language, a general environment that is required to be present, and a C API to enable programmers to call into this environment.

Web28 de mar. de 2024 · nvc++ is a C++17 compiler for NVIDIA GPUs and AMD, Intel, OpenPOWER, and Arm CPUs. and linker for the target processors with options derived from its command line arguments. nvc++ supports ISO C++17, supports GPU and multicore CPU programming with C++17 parallel algorithms, OpenACC, and OpenMP. Web6 de ago. de 2024 · OpenCL is an abbreviated form for "Open Computing Language". It is a programming language that can be used across diverse platforms, primarily for accelerated computing.Due to its diverse nature of applicabilities across multiple platforms, it is most often referred to as a cross-platform computing language. You can write programs on …

Web23 de mai. de 2014 · Fortran is a very popular language, and so I wouldn't be at all surprised if we see one or more efforts to produce a compiler for writing OpenCL kernels …

Web23 de mai. de 2014 · Fortran is a very popular language, and so I wouldn't be at all surprised if we see one or more efforts to produce a compiler for writing OpenCL kernels … grace church fishersWebThe tool supports C, C++, Fortran, SYCL, OpenMP, OpenCL™ code, and Python. It helps design performant applications on CPU for efficient threading, vectorization, and memory use. The expanded Offload Modeling capability helps to ensure efficient GPU offload: identify parts of the code that can be profitably offloaded and optimize the code for … grace church fireWebAs transpyle is under heavy development, the API might change significantly between versions. Language support. Transpyle intends to support selected subsets of: C, C++, … chilkoot meaningWeb3 de set. de 2015 · 58. Python에서 C, Fortran, CUDA-C, OpenCL-C와 쉽게 연동 할 수 있다 수치모델 메인은 Python으로 작성, 계산이 집중된 부분만 컴파일 언어로 대체한다. 계산성능이 중요한 대규모의 과학계산 분야에서도 Python은 훌륭한 대안이 될 수 있다 Wrap up 59. chilkoot national his trailWebclinfo – Find all possible (known) properties of the OpenCL platform and devices available on the system. cuda_memtest AUR – a GPU memtest. Despite its name, is supports … grace church fishers inWebIn this paper, we use the PSyclone source-to-source code generation and transformation system to automatically translate a subset of the Fortran language to OpenCL for weather and climate applications conforming to the PSyKAl kernel-based parallelism model. grace church flat rock miWebC/C++ or Fortran with OpenMP* Offload Programming Model. The Intel® oneAPI DPC++/C++ Compiler and the Intel® Fortran Compiler (Beta) enable software … chilkoot national historic site